1)bean对象的初始化方法
2)bean对象销毁之前的执行方法
在java类中定义初始化和销毁方法
在容器配置文件中定义<bean>的时候制定init-method=“初始化方法名”,destroy-method=“销毁方法名”
定义初始化方法,相当于构造方法的作用,在构造方法之后执行。
方法的原型是:public void 方法名自定义()
例:public void setup(){
System.out.println("执行对象的初始化操作,例如创建连接Connection,属性赋值等");
}
定义销毁方法,对象销毁之前执行的方法,一般是用来清除内存,回收资源的。
方法的原型是:public void 方法名自定义()
例:public void setup(){
System.out.println("执行销毁方法,在容器关闭之前执行");
}
PS:销毁方法执行:
1.容器关闭,调用close方法
2.对象必须是单例的